broom
noun
  1. a long-handled brush of bristles or twigs, used for sweeping
    扫帚
    ■an implement for sweeping the ice in the game of curling
    (冰上溜石游戏中的)扫雪帚
  2. a flowering shrub with long, thin green stems and small or few leaves, cultivated for its profusion of flowers
    金雀儿;染料木
  3. Cytisus, Genista, and related genera, family Leguminosae: many species and cultivars
    金雀儿属,染料木属及其相关属,豆科:多种和栽培品种
常用词组
a new broom sweeps clean
  1. (proverb)people newly appointed to positions of responsibility tend to make far-reaching changes
    (谚)新官上任三把火
    the company seems set to make a fresh start under a new broom.
    新领导来了,看来公司面貌要焕然一新了。
语源
  1. Old English brōm (in sense 2), of Germanic origin; related to Dutch braam, also to bramble
